Comprehending Commercial Windows
Commercial windows are designed to stand up to the rigors of high traffic and varying weather conditions. They are usually bigger and more robust than residential windows, often featuring customized materials and finishings to enhance sturdiness and energy performance. These windows can be made from numerous products, including aluminum, steel, and composite products, each with its own set of benefits and maintenance requirements.
Common Issues with Commercial WindowsCracked or Broken Glass: One of the most common concerns, especially in high-traffic areas, is cracked or broken glass. This can be triggered by unintentional effects, extreme weather condition, and even thermal tension.Seal Failure: Over time, the seals that keep the window panes airtight can degrade, causing drafts, moisture infiltration, and increased energy expenses.Hardware Malfunction: Locks, hinges, and other hardware can use out or become misaligned, making it hard to open or close windows properly.Frame Damage: The frames of industrial windows can warp, rot, or corrode, particularly in environments with high humidity or exposure to the elements.Condensation: Excessive condensation between the panes of double-glazed windows can decrease exposure and show a failed seal.Energy Inefficiency: Older windows may not satisfy present energy effectiveness standards, causing greater cooling and heating expenses.The Importance of Timely Maintenance
Regular maintenance is crucial for the longevity and efficiency of commercial windows. Neglecting these jobs can lead to more significant and pricey repairs down the line. Here are some key upkeep practices:
Inspection: Regularly inspect windows for indications of damage, such as fractures, loose seals, and used hardware.Cleaning up: Clean windows and frames to remove dust, dirt, and particles that can build up and trigger damage.Lubrication: Lubricate moving parts to ensure smooth operation and prevent wear.Seal Replacement: Replace damaged or deteriorated seals to maintain airtightness and energy effectiveness.Expert Inspections: Schedule routine expert examinations to capture problems early and prevent them from intensifying.Benefits of Professional Commercial Window Repair

The procedure of business window repair normally includes several steps:
Assessment: A professional specialist will examine the windows to identify the specific concerns and figure out the best strategy.Quotation: Based on the assessment, the technician will supply an in-depth quotation for the repair work.Scheduling: Once the quote is authorized, the repair work is set up at a time that minimizes disruption to the business.Preparation: The area around the windows is prepared to protect the surrounding surface areas and ensure a clean work environment.Repair: The professional will carry out the necessary repairs, which may include replacement of glass, seals, hardware, or frames.Testing: After the repair, the specialist will test the windows to guarantee they function appropriately and satisfy all security and efficiency standards.Cleanup: The workspace is cleaned up, and any debris is gotten rid of.Last Inspection: A last inspection is performed to make sure the repair fulfills the customer's fulfillment.FAQs About Commercial Window RepairWhat are the signs that my industrial windows require repair?Split or broken glassDrafts or air leaksProblem opening or closing windowsNoticeable damage to frames or hardwareExcessive condensation between panesHow typically should commercial windows be examined?It is advised to check commercial windows a minimum of once a year, with more frequent assessments in high-traffic or harsh environments.Can I repair industrial windows myself?Small problems, such as cleansing and lubrication, can typically be dealt with internal. However, more complex repairs must be delegated experts to guarantee security and quality.How much does industrial window repair expense?The expense can vary widely depending on the level of the damage and the type of windows. Easy repairs, such as changing a seal, might cost a couple of hundred dollars, while more extensive repairs, like replacing a frame, can cost several thousand dollars.What should I try to find when selecting a business window repair service?Look for a service with an excellent reputation, experienced specialists, and a track record of quality work. Examine for reviews, certifications, and guarantees on their services.How long does business window repair take?The duration can vary depending upon the intricacy of the repair. Simple repairs may be completed in a couple of hours, while more comprehensive projects can take a day or more.
